<<62>> adulteration adulteration can be defined

<<65>> as a process

<<67>> by which quality or nature of a given

<<69>> oil is

<<70>> reduced through addition of our foreign

<<73>> or inferior

<<74>> substances like for example orange oil

<<78>> yuzu and grapefruit oils are 99

<<82>> similar oils with each other

<<85>> but they have a huge price difference 20

<<88>> to

<<89>> 100 times and they are easy to mix as

<<92>> well

<<93>> certainly there is a huge aroma

<<96>> difference

<<97>> between yuzu orange and grapefruit oils

<<100>> mixing of lavending in lavender a mixing

<<103>> of geranium in rose oils etc etc

<<1219>> i talk a lot about marker

<<1222>> on my previous slides let me explain

<<1226>> what are they

<<1228>> particularly i classify marker into two

<<1230>> categories

<<1231>> biomarkers and synthetic marker

<<1234>> biomarkers are unique characteristics

<<1236>> molecule

<<1237>> of the individual oil which is

<<1239>> commercially unavailable

<<1240>> to adulterate oils if some addition is

<<1243>> happened

<<1244>> by a marker of unrelated oil appears or

<<1246>> biomarkers of the

<<1248>> adulterated oil disappears like for

<<1250>> example

<<1251>> if corn meat oil is

<<1255>> added in peppermint oil you will see low

<<1257>> burner floral low carbohydrate d

<<1259>> low methyl fluoride on peppermint corn

<<1261>> mint is a cheaper oil

<<1264>> oils have similar chemistry to

<<1266>> peppermint oil

<<1267>> but cornmeal does not have those

<<1269>> molecules

<<1272>> lowering of those molecule or

<<1273>> disappearance of those molecules

<<1276>> in any peppermint oil definitely

<<1277>> indicates adulteration

<<1279>> in peppermint oil so vertebral

<<1282>> fluorosarmactin d

<<1283>> and menthopiran are biomarker peppermint

<<1286>> essential oil the impurities of the

<<1290>> synthetic molecules are all

<<1291>> are called synthetic marker the

<<1293>> appearance of synthetic markers

<<1295>> in oils indicate adulteration

<<1298>> with synthetic chemicals like for

<<1299>> example synthetic glynol

<<1301>> if you added in any linoleum containing

<<1304>> oils

<<1304>> you will see the hydroline aloe as a

<<1306>> synthetic marker of the linoleum edison

<<1309>> which you do not see in any pure

<<1311>> essential oil
